What Should You Consider When Choosing the Best Cheapest Pressure Washer?

When selecting the best cheapest pressure washer, several key factors should be considered to ensure you get the best value for your money.

  • Pressure Rating: The pressure rating, measured in PSI (pounds per square inch), indicates the cleaning power of the pressure washer. A higher PSI allows for more effective cleaning of tough stains and grime, making it essential to choose a model that meets your specific cleaning needs.
  • Water Flow Rate: The water flow rate, measured in GPM (gallons per minute), determines how much water the pressure washer can deliver. A higher GPM means faster cleaning, as it can cover larger areas more quickly, which is particularly useful for washing driveways, decks, and vehicles.
  • Portability: Consider the weight and design of the pressure washer, especially if you plan to move it around frequently. Models with wheels and a lightweight frame are easier to transport, while compact designs can save space in storage.
  • Power Source: Pressure washers can be powered by electricity or gas, and your choice will affect performance and convenience. Electric models are typically quieter, lighter, and require less maintenance, while gas models offer greater power and are suitable for larger jobs but can be more cumbersome to handle.
  • Accessories and Attachments: Check what accessories come with the pressure washer, such as different nozzles, extension wands, or surface cleaners. These attachments can enhance versatility, allowing you to tackle a variety of cleaning tasks more efficiently.
  • Durability and Warranty: Look for pressure washers made from high-quality materials that can withstand regular use. A good warranty can also provide peace of mind, protecting your investment in case of manufacturing defects or issues that may arise over time.
  • User Reviews and Ratings: Research customer feedback to gauge the reliability and performance of the pressure washer you are considering. Reviews can provide insights into real-world experiences, helping you make a more informed decision based on the experiences of others.

How Does Pressure and Flow Rate Affect Cleaning Performance?

Pressure and flow rate are critical factors that significantly impact the cleaning performance of pressure washers.

  • Pressure: The pressure of a pressure washer is measured in pounds per square inch (PSI) and determines the force with which water is expelled from the nozzle. Higher pressure can effectively remove stubborn dirt and grime from surfaces, making it ideal for tough cleaning tasks like stripping paint or blasting away mold.
  • Flow Rate: Flow rate, indicated in gallons per minute (GPM), measures the volume of water that the pressure washer can deliver. A higher flow rate allows for quicker cleaning by covering more surface area in a shorter amount of time, making it especially useful for larger areas such as driveways or patios.
  • Combination of Pressure and Flow Rate: The effectiveness of cleaning is not solely dependent on pressure or flow rate alone but rather their combination. For example, a machine with high pressure but low flow rate may clean more effectively on tough stains, while one with lower pressure and higher flow rate can rinse surfaces thoroughly, ensuring no residue is left behind.
  • Surface Compatibility: Different surfaces require different pressure and flow settings for optimal cleaning. Delicate surfaces like wood or painted areas benefit from lower pressure to avoid damage, while hard surfaces like concrete can withstand higher pressure without risk.
  • Cleaning Attachments: The use of various nozzles and attachments can also influence how pressure and flow rate interact during cleaning. Turbo nozzles can increase the effective cleaning power by combining high pressure with a rotating spray pattern, improving efficiency on tough surfaces.

How Can Proper Maintenance Extend the Life of a Budget Pressure Washer?

Proper maintenance can significantly extend the lifespan of a budget pressure washer, ensuring reliable performance and efficient cleaning.

  • Regular Cleaning: Keeping the pressure washer clean prevents dirt and grime from building up on components, which can lead to corrosion and operational issues.
  • Check and Change Oil: Regularly checking and changing the oil in gas-powered pressure washers helps maintain engine performance and prevents overheating, which can cause serious damage.
  • Inspect Hoses and Connections: Routinely inspecting hoses for cracks, leaks, or wear ensures that water pressure remains consistent and prevents costly repairs or replacements.
  • Winterization: Preparing the pressure washer for storage during colder months by draining water and adding antifreeze can prevent internal damage from freezing temperatures.
  • Use the Right Detergents: Using compatible cleaning agents protects internal components and prevents damage to seals and hoses, ensuring longevity and optimal performance.
  • Follow Manufacturer Guidelines: Adhering to the manufacturer’s maintenance recommendations, including service intervals and parts replacement, ensures that the pressure washer operates efficiently and lasts longer.

Regular cleaning removes dirt and grime that can cause corrosion or blockage in the system, allowing the pressure washer to perform at its best without unnecessary strain on its components.

Checking and changing the oil is crucial for gas models, as fresh oil lubricates engine parts, reduces friction, and helps dissipate heat, which can prolong engine life significantly.

Inspecting hoses and connections prevents leaks and sudden loss of pressure, which not only affects cleaning efficiency but can also lead to more serious mechanical issues over time.

Winterization involves draining the water from the system to avoid freeze damage; adding antifreeze is also a protective measure that can save the pressure washer from costly repairs.

Using the right detergents is essential because inappropriate cleaners can degrade seals and hoses, leading to leaks and reduced effectiveness, while proper ones enhance cleaning without harming the machine.

Finally, following the manufacturer’s guidelines ensures that all maintenance tasks are completed as recommended, which helps maintain warranty coverage and ensures optimal operation throughout the pressure washer’s life.
